探讨一下导致Gitee日志无法合并提交的原因和解决方法

发布时间 - 2023-04-10 00:00:00    点击率:

gitee是一种基于git的代码托管平台,并提供了丰富的管理工具和代码开发流程。在使用gitee进行代码的管理过程中,常常会遇到需要合并多次提交的情况。但是,很多用户在使用gitee时发现,无法通过日志的方式将多次提交合并为一次提交。那么,究竟是什么原因导致了gitee日志无法合并提交呢?下面我们来探讨一下。

首先要明确的是,Git是一种分布式版本控制系统,每个用户本地都有一份完整的代码库。当多个用户同时对同一份代码进行修改时,可能会出现代码冲突的情况。为了解决这个问题,Git提供了一种分支机制,即每个开发者可以在本地创建分支,执行自己的修改操作,最后将分支合并到主分支中。这样就可以避免多个开发者对同一份代码同时进行修改所导致的冲突问题。

在使用Gitee过程中,有很多用户常常使用日志功能来记录每次代码提交的信息。但是,在使用日志来合并多次提交时,可能会遇到无法合并的问题。这是由于,Gitee日志不是用来合并提交的,而是用来检查版本历史记录的工具。如果想要合并代码,应该使用Git的分支和合并功能。

实际上,Git提供了多种合并方式,例如合并两个不同的分支或合并同一分支的两个或多个不同的提交。而在Gitee上合并代码的方式也非常简单。只需要在项目页面中,选择“合并请求”功能,将需要合并的分支或提交选择合并即可。在提交合并请求时,可以选择创建一个新的分支,也可以选择将合并结果直接合并到主分支中。通过这种方式,可以很方便地合并多次提交。

此外,还需要注意的是,为了避免出现代码冲突,尽量遵循多人协作开发的标准流程,即遵循Git的分支和合并功能,以及代码自动化测试、代码评审等流程,保证每次提交的代码都是可用的。这样可以有效地提升代码质量,减少代码冲突的可能性。

综上所述,Gitee日志不能用来合并提交的原因是因为它主要是用于检查版本历史记录的工具。在合并代码时,应该使用Git的分支和合并功能。而为了避免代码冲突,推荐使用多人协作开发的标准流程,包括Git的分支和合并功能,以及自动化测试、代码评审等流程。这样可以有效地提高代码质量,减少代码冲突的可能性。最后,希望本文对大家有所帮助。


# 分布式  # git  # 自动化  # gitee  # 多个  # 的是  # 是一种  # 有效地  # 历史记录  # 可以选择  # 为了避免  # 过程中  # 自己的  # 都是 


相关栏目: 【 网站优化151355 】 【 网络推广146373 】 【 网络技术251813 】 【 AI营销90571


相关推荐: 奇安信“盘古石”团队突破 iOS 26.1 提权  如何制作公司的网站链接,公司想做一个网站,一般需要花多少钱?  胶州企业网站制作公司,青岛石头网络科技有限公司怎么样?  jimdo怎样用html5做选项卡_jimdo选项卡html5实现与切换效果【指南】  如何在IIS中新建站点并配置端口与物理路径?  Laravel如何处理和验证JSON类型的数据库字段  Laravel如何为API生成Swagger或OpenAPI文档  Python文件流缓冲机制_IO性能解析【教程】  网站制作企业,网站的banner和导航栏是指什么?  Bootstrap CSS布局之列表  小米17系列还有一款新机?主打6.9英寸大直屏和旗舰级影像  浅析上传头像示例及其注意事项  在线制作视频的网站有哪些,电脑如何制作视频短片?  宙斯浏览器视频悬浮窗怎么开启 边看视频边操作其他应用教程  简单实现jsp分页  安克发布新款氮化镓充电宝:体积缩小 30%,支持 200W 输出  如何在香港服务器上快速搭建免备案网站?  如何挑选最适合建站的高性能VPS主机?  如何获取免费开源的自助建站系统源码?  如何在Windows环境下新建FTP站点并设置权限?  网站优化排名时,需要考虑哪些问题呢?  Laravel怎么实现观察者模式Observer_Laravel模型事件监听与解耦开发【指南】  Laravel Session怎么存储_Laravel Session驱动配置详解  详解Huffman编码算法之Java实现  Laravel怎么做缓存_Laravel Cache系统提升应用速度的策略与技巧  在线教育网站制作平台,山西立德教育官网?  如何在建站主机中优化服务器配置?  作用域操作符会触发自动加载吗_php类自动加载机制与::调用【教程】  Laravel如何部署到服务器_线上部署Laravel项目的完整流程与步骤  Edge浏览器提示“由你的组织管理”怎么解决_去除浏览器托管提示【修复】  Windows11怎样设置电源计划_Windows11电源计划调整攻略【指南】  如何在阿里云高效完成企业建站全流程?  Python文本处理实践_日志清洗解析【指导】  韩国网站服务器搭建指南:VPS选购、域名解析与DNS配置推荐  Laravel 419 page expired怎么解决_Laravel CSRF令牌过期处理  详解CentOS6.5 安装 MySQL5.1.71的方法  Laravel怎么实现一对多关联查询_Laravel Eloquent模型关系定义与预加载【实战】  php嵌入式断网后怎么恢复_php检测网络重连并恢复硬件控制【操作】  Laravel如何实现数据库事务?(DB Facade示例)  如何快速搭建个人网站并优化SEO?  Laravel如何编写单元测试和功能测试?(PHPUnit示例)  详解jQuery中基本的动画方法  详解Oracle修改字段类型方法总结  装修招标网站设计制作流程,装修招标流程?  免费制作统计图的网站有哪些,如何看待现如今年轻人买房难的情况?  Laravel项目结构怎么组织_大型Laravel应用的最佳目录结构实践  Android自定义控件实现温度旋转按钮效果  深圳网站制作设计招聘,关于服装设计的流行趋势,哪里的资料比较全面?  ChatGPT 4.0官网入口地址 ChatGPT在线体验官网  如何挑选优质建站一级代理提升网站排名?